Read This First

Please read the following important safety instructions carefully
before using this scanner. Failure to observe these instructions may
result in personal injuries or damages to the scanner.

Important safety instructions

Always follow these basic safety precautions when using the
scanner. This will reduce the risk of fire, electric shock, and injury.
Do not place this scanner under direct sunlight or near heat
sources, such as in a closed car under sunlight or near a
stove. The outer casing of this device may become
deformed and the sophisticated sensors inside may become
damaged due to excessive heat.
Do not use this device near water, in the rain or allow any
liquid to get inside this device. Water and moisture may
cause short-circuit to the electronic components and lead
to malfunctions.
Do not use this device in dusty environments. Dust grains
may cover this device and scratch the original. Do not scan
originals that are contaminated by dusts or other particles.
Do not use this device near strong electromagnetic
sources, such as a microwave oven or television. The
electromagnetic interference may cause this device to
malfunction.
Do not attempt to disassemble or modify this device. There
are no user-serviceable parts inside this device, and
unauthorized modifications will void your warranty.
Do not drop or apply shock/vibration to this device. Strong
impacts may damage the components inside.
